Output 3e586a213805ea308356d8d29fc2496cc6e0f41d82a029f317f1bb2296b2f222:0

value
9777205
script pubkey
OP_HASH160 OP_PUSHBYTES_20 771a277c789cb0a4d01f975de910eedbc167e9cf OP_EQUAL
address
3CYmfbmTCweUpSJ3BChrDjhLqiK32cZRgX
transaction
3e586a213805ea308356d8d29fc2496cc6e0f41d82a029f317f1bb2296b2f222
confirmations
364998
spent
true